    Abstract: A method including determining a position of each glyph in an image of a text document, identifying word boundaries in the document thereby implying the existence of a first plurality of words, preparing a first array of word lengths based on the first plurality of words, preparing a second array of word lengths based on a second plurality of words of a text file including a certain text, comparing at least part of the first array to at least part of the second array to find a best alignment between the first and second array, deriving a layout of at least part of the certain text as arranged in the image of the text document at least based on the best alignment and the position of at least some of the glyphs in the image. Related apparatus and methods are also described.

    Abstract: A computer program obfuscating system including a processor to provide a computer program including at least one computer program variable, and add an opaque predicate to the computer program to obfuscate the computer program so that the opaque predicate added to the computer program comprises at least one polynomial including a polynomial P, during execution of the obfuscated computer program, the polynomial P is evaluated yielding at least one result including a first result R1, and during execution of the obfuscated computer program, the opaque predicate is evaluated based on the at least one result R1 such that a decision as to whether or not to perform the first command is dependent upon comparing the first result R1 to at least one value in accordance with a predetermined mathematical relationship. Related apparatus and methods are also included.
